Systems and Operations

IT Systems and Operations provides much of the behind-the-scenes work that makes communication and computers on campus work. Systems and Operations consists of these key areas:

Facilities, Systems, and Operations

  • Offers system and application monitoring and Outage Notification Process for the data centers housing Purdue's production infrastructure systems
  • Provides service management and project management for infrastructure-related and customer components and efforts

Infrastructure Services

  • Administers Windows, Mainframe, and UNIX systems as well as enterprise storage assets including SAN, NAS, and backup hardware and associated management software

Current initiatives and projects

  • Machine room expansion: Manages space to access existing systems and enable growth, disaster recovery, and business continuity support
  • Upgrade to Oracle: Implements the 10g version of this database environment in two phases
  • Web-hosting re-architecture: Designs a new, robust web-hosting environment with new versions of Tomcat, Apache, ColdFusion, and more
